Euler Complexes (Oiks)
We present a class of instances of the existence of a second object of a specified type, in fact, of an even number of objects of a specified type, which generalizes the existence of an equilibrium for bimatrix games. The proof is an abstract generalization of the Lemke-Howson algorithm for finding an equilibrium of a bimatrix game. Versions of this note, with various examples, were presented at a Dagstuhl conference in 2007, the Paris TGGT conference in 2008, and the Bonn conference, "Recent trends in Combinatorial Optimization", proceedings: Springer, 2009. The version here is meant meant to be updated convenience for the session on Oiks, ISCO, 2010.
